1. Paris Christmas Markets
The festive spirit completely fills every Parisian district. You will find quaint Christmas Markets everywhere. These delightful venues are placed across the city’s neighborhoods.
They are an essential part of the holiday events experience. Wander past the specialized wooden vendor stalls. You can purchase delightful regional food items. Savor a glass of hot vin chaud (spiced wine).
Seek out unique, handcrafted Parisian souvenirs. The mood feels genuinely joyous and celebratory. It provides an ideal, entertaining outing for all visitors. These markets offer an authentic glimpse. They showcase French holiday traditions in a wonderful urban setting.
Visit the large market at the Tuileries Garden. It offers numerous high-end items. The Marché Saint-Germain is smaller but sophisticated. It focuses on unique decorations.
2. Holiday Lights & Window Displays
A major element of what’s on in Paris during winter is the impressive city lighting. The street illumination is truly a marvelous sight. The famous avenue, the Champs-Élysées, becomes dazzling.
It is dressed in an archway of sparkling lights. This exhibit sets a global standard for seasonal style. The department store window displays are equally captivating.
View the Galeries Lafayette and Printemps creations. These artistic, intricate vignettes are internationally known. They often tell complex festive stories. Seeing them is a uniquely charming ritual.
This spectacle is truly a Paris experience you can’t miss. It is an exceptional way to absorb the magical Paris holiday events atmosphere. Other commercial streets feature bespoke installations. Avenue Montaigen highlights high-fashion lighting.

4. New Year’s Eve Celebrations
Greeting the new year in Paris feels truly magnificent. The city does not host one massive fireworks spectacle. Yet the ambiance for New Year’s Eve remains sensational.
The best location for an iconic countdown is the Champs-Élysées. Large crowds gather in this location. They witness a light and video presentation. It is projected onto the historic Arc de Triomphe.
This show concludes with a brilliant finale. For a more sophisticated gathering, many venues host private parties. These include formal ticketed party galas.

1. Seine River Cruise at Night
The Seine River serves as the city’s geographic lifeline. A river cruise offers a top option among the best things to do in Paris. Once darkness falls, key landmarks illuminate.
This includes the Louvre, the Musée d’Orsay, and the Eiffel Tower structure. This illumination creates an unparalleled scenic view. A dinner cruise adds an element of high refinement.
It expertly combines fine French cooking with stunning sightseeing. Observing the urban environment transform is captivating. It shifts from evening dusk to a glittering display. This perspective offers a beautiful and sentimental memory.
It is ideal for couples or any special moment. Book a vessel with a private top deck. This ensures a more exclusive viewing area.
Several highly rated companies offer diverse departure times daily. You should check if your cruise departs from Pont de l’Alma.

4. Day Trips to Versailles
Seek a momentary break from the capital’s bustle. A quick trip to the Château de Versailles is highly recommended. It offers a detailed immersion into France’s monarchical past.
The massive size of the palace is remarkable. Its interior decoration is lavish. The extensive, carefully managed gardens are breathtaking. Exploring this significant World Heritage site adds historical context. It clarifies the nation’s regal legacy.
Plan a full day for this historic property. The expansive grounds alone require substantial walking time. An alternative involves checking local listings.
Search for upcoming festivals in Paris for tourists in the surrounding region. Many special happenings occur just outside the city center. These trips guarantee a wonderful day excursion. The palace is easily reached via the RER C train.

6. Winter Walks in Luxembourg Gardens or Montmartre
The most fulfilling Parisian moments are often the most simple. Take a peaceful winter stroll. Walk through the elegant Luxembourg Gardens.
Explore the endearing, stone-paved streets of Montmartre. These settings reveal the city’s intrinsic charm. They give travelers a chance to try top non-touristy things to do.
You simply observe local activities and stunning buildings. For groups with younger members, search for specific listings.
Look for “Family friendly events” that might occur. They may be located in the large parks or public squares. The summit of Montmartre provides expansive city vistas.
The prominent Sacré-Cœur Basilica crowns the hill. This area offers historical and spiritual depth. Montmartre has several quiet vineyards.
